Output 63e3195bcc354bf5dccd99e914aa26377816897616cc695079fba433eb5e7517:13
- value
- 45425676
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fb0934c05d61d2a673753f43e1ad37d5bc8d51a
- address
- bc1q37cfxnq96cwj5eeh206ruxkn04du34g62r3tfd
- transaction
- 63e3195bcc354bf5dccd99e914aa26377816897616cc695079fba433eb5e7517